AI Summary
-
Recognizes January 27, 2026 as "International Holocaust Remembrance Day" in Rhode Island, commemorating the 81st anniversary of the liberation of Auschwitz where more than 1.1 million people were murdered
-
Acknowledges the Holocaust resulted in the systematic murder of approximately six million Jews, plus millions of others including Roma, Poles, disabled individuals, LGBTQ+ individuals, Soviet prisoners of war, and political dissidents
-
Notes a sharp rise in antisemitism and extremism in Rhode Island, across the country, and around the world in the past year
-
Encourages Rhode Island citizens to participate in educational programs about the Holocaust and the ongoing fight against hatred, discrimination, and antisemitism
-
Directs the Secretary of State to transmit certified copies to the U.S. Holocaust Memorial Museum, Rhode Island Holocaust Museum, Jewish Alliance of Greater Rhode Island, Jewish Community Center of Rhode Island, and Rhode Island Israel Collaborative
